Abdul Khaliq H is an emerging innovator in the field of autonomous robotics and mechatronic systems, with a focused expertise in developing life-saving hardware solutions. His most cited work, the "Autonomous Subsurface Exploration and Extraction System," represents a major contribution to rescue robotics. This project introduces a sophisticated robotic arm designed for borewell rescue operations, integrating a robotic hook, vacuum pump, and precision control systems powered by Raspberry Pi or Arduino. By employing Lidar sensors for real-time data acquisition, his system enables autonomous subsurface navigation and victim extraction, directly addressing a critical gap in emergency response technology.
